FSRU LNG Croatia Makes Triumphant Return Home

The FSRU vessel LNG Croatia has successfully returned to its LNG terminal after a significant period away. The vessel has been in transit for 55 days.
Return to the LNG Terminal
Docking at the LNG terminal in Omišalj, on the island of Krk, marks a crucial milestone for the FSRU LNG Croatia. This return follows the installation of a new regasification module and the completion of a five-year class renewal.
Preparation for Commissioning
With the vessel now situated at the terminal, preparations for its commissioning will commence. This phase includes final inspections and testing of both the FSRU vessel and the terminal’s onshore components.
The primary goal is to ensure a safe and reliable start for commercial operations, scheduled for 26 October 2025.
